Comparative valuation analysis is a catch-all model that can be used if you cannot value Vonage Holdings by discounting back its dividends or cash flows. This model doesn't attempt to find an intrinsic value for Vonage Holdings' Stock . Still, instead, it compares the stock's price multiples to a benchmark or nearest competition to determine if the stock is relatively undervalued or overvalued. The reason why the comparable model can be used in almost all circumstances is due to the vast number of multiples that can be utilized, such as the price-to-earnings (P/E), price-to-book (P/B), price-to-sales (P/S), price-to-cash flow (P/CF), and many others. The P/E ratio is the most commonly used of these ratios because it focuses on the Vonage Holdings' earnings, one of the primary drivers of an investment's value.

Vonage Holdings Corp. primarily operates as a cloud communications company in the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, the European Union, and Asia. As of July 21, 2022, Vonage Holdings Corp. operates as a subsidiary of Telefonaktiebolaget LM Ericsson . Vonage Holdings operates under Telecom Services classification in the United States and is traded on NMS Exchange. It employs 2082 people.
